How Bullwhips Can Be Used

There are different ways in which bullwhips can be used.  Bullwhips could be used to create a pain stimulus or otherwise.  Bullwhips may also be used to gently convey a message or to make loud sounds.  Although there are different ways in which bullwhips can be used, special care should be taken to ensure proper use because bullwhips can cause severe damage including cuts and broken bones.   Bullwhips can also damage items and equipment.

In many situations, bullwhips are used to control animals such as livestock.  This is because bullwhip users can acquire compliance through the infliction of pain as a result of the impact of the whipping effect of the whip.  The impact or sound of the whip helps to move animals from one place to another. The pain acts as a stimulus and can be used in training horses and other animals.  The use of a bullwhip in training animals is permitted in some areas.  In such circumstances, regulatory bodies are in place to ensure that there is no abuse with the bullwhip.  Nevertheless, there are areas where animal rights groups protest the use of such methods.  Still, bullwhips remain a popular choice for controlling animals in equestrian disciplines and also in controlling livestock.

There are also instances when no pain occurs when the bullwhip is used.  In these circumstances, the bullwhip is used as a sign or visual communication medium to convey a message.  Skilled bullwhip users may use the bullwhip to simply tap an object or an animal to indicate a directive or required action.  Based on how the bullwhip is used and the pattern through which conditioning has occurred, the bullwhip can provide reinforcement, correction, negative feedback or awareness.

Bullwhips can break the sound barrier when the tip of the whip moves at very high speeds.  The resulting sound resembles a cracking sound and is described as a mini sonic boom.  In order to create the sonic boom sound, the bullwhip needs to be of the long variety as this will assist the tail gather enough momentum to create the force needed to flow through the tail-end of the whip.  Apart from the sonic boom sound, bullwhips may also be used to strike other objects to create equally loud sounds.  These loud sounds can be used to exert control over animals due to fear of loud noises.  Hence, the sound of the whip is an effective control mechanism.
